CVE-2005-1430
Disclosure Date: May 03,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
Mac OS X 10.3.x and earlier uses insecure permissions for a pseudo terminal tty (pty) that is managed by a non-setuid program, which allows local users to read or modify sessions of other users.

CVE-2005-0975
Disclosure Date: May 02,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
Integer signedness error in the parse_machfile function in the mach-o loader (mach_loader.c) for the Darwin Kernel as used in Mac OS X 10.3.7, and other versions before 10.3.9, allows local users to cause a denial of service (CPU consumption) via a crafted mach-o header.

CVE-2005-0342
Disclosure Date: May 02,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
The Finder in Mac OS X and earlier allows local users to overwrite arbitrary files and gain privileges by creating a hard link from the .DS_Store file to an arbitrary file.

CVE-2005-0713
Disclosure Date: March 21,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
The Bluetooth Setup Assistant for Mac OS X before 10.3.8 can be launched without a keyboard or Bluetooth device, which allows local users to bypass access restrictions and gain privileges.

CVE-2005-0715
Disclosure Date: March 21,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
AFP Server in Mac OS X before 10.3.8 uses insecure permissions for "Drop Boxes," which allows local users to read the contents of a Drop Box.

CVE-2005-0716
Disclosure Date: March 21,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
Stack-based buffer overflow in the Core Foundation Library in Mac OS X 10.3.5 and 10.3.6, and possibly earlier versions, allows local users to execute arbitrary code via a long CF_CHARSET_PATH environment variable.

CVE-2004-0922
Disclosure Date: January 27,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
AFP Server on Mac OS X 10.3.x to 10.3.5, under certain conditions, does not properly set the guest group ID, which causes AFP to change a write-only AFP Drop Box to be read-write when the Drop Box is on a share that is mounted by a guest, which allows attackers to read the Drop Box.

CVE-2004-0924
Disclosure Date: January 27,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
NetInfo Manager on Mac OS X 10.3.x through 10.3.5, after an initial root login, reports the root account as being disabled, even when it has not.

CVE-2004-0921
Disclosure Date: January 27,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
AFP Server on Mac OS X 10.3.x to 10.3.5, when a guest has mounted an AFP volume, allows the guest to "terminate authenticated user mounts" via modified SessionDestroy packets.

CVE-2004-0927
Disclosure Date: January 27, 2005 (last updated February 22, 2025)
ServerAdmin in Mac OS X 10.2.8 through 10.3.5 uses the same example self-signed certificate on each system, which allows remote attackers to decrypt sessions.
